"Unable to stop drive
Timeout was reached"
Using Mint 19 Mate Linux 4.15.0-24-generic
Mate 1.20.1
Caja 1.20.2
It's not a hardware issue, since this happens with Mint19-Mate on both laptop and desktop, nor is it my method of removal, since I have never had these "timeout" issues with Mint (Mate)17, or Mint (Mate)18 before.
https://www.pclinuxos.com/forum/index.p ... gngbasjt16
It's not just "timeout" issues with external USB drives either.
If I'm downloading to my drive, after about 30 min. I get the "Unable To stop drive...timeout" popup up, even though, after a clean reboot prior,
there were no external drives plugged in?.
So something has changed in Mint 19 Mate and/or caja ...?, and again, i never seen these issues before using Mint Mate in older versions.

Re: Mate19 ERROR: Unable to stop drive Timeout was reached ?
...i think that most likely you are affected by this. Try checking your logs for gvfs-related errors.
If such is the case indeed, this should affect not just Mint and Mate, but other distros & desktops as well.
...See here as well, for Arch & Thunar.
Post #12 contains an unofficial patched binary for Bionic (if you trust such of course).
In any case, it says 'Fix Committed', so Canonical will provide a corrected package anytime soon...
